What companies run services between Bedford, England and Hainault, England?

There is no direct connection from Bedford to Hainault. However, you can take the train to London Blackfriars, walk to St. Paul's station, then take the subway to Hainault station. Alternatively, you can take a bus from St Paul's Square to Hainault station via Airport Bus Station, Marble Arch, and Marble Arch station in around 3h 47m.
